What sort of power were you running rob? And how was the power delivery?
it ran 460 bhp & 500 ft/lbs. Ran a 9.1:1 compression ratio engine with ported headers. spooled from 2200rpm hit peak torque at 3900rpm and pulled to peak power at 6100rpm.
immense to drive, bit hairy in the wet giving it beans from a stand still

It worked out a lot cheaper than 1600 as it was around 1k for the turbo and a new larger inlet pipe and oil feed kit all in
Iv hit 420 on standard 565s and maxed them out , im swapping to 800cc and been told that's fine for the 500+ I'm after so 750 would be fine imo
Got loads of parts always laying around so I'm just using some sard ones that iv had spare but I'm told there good ones and spray well so should do the job just fine , Perrin rails , SX FPR ,sytec external pump and under bonnet swirl pot should sort my fuel shortage out for a while
